MGMT to play Saint Paul with Beck on September 30

mgmt_ferret.JPG

MGMT (whom I love, btw) will be joining Beck on the road, including a stop in Saint Paul.

Presale tickets will be made available at www.whoismgmt.com in advance of the public on-sales for the shows starting this Wednesday, July 16th and can also be purchased through Ticketbastard.
